Ceist choitianta: Conas línte dúblacha a chomhaireamh in Unix?

Is fóntais líne ordaithe é an t-ordú uniq in UNIX chun línte arís agus arís eile a thuairisciú nó a scagadh i gcomhad. Féadann sé dúbailtí a bhaint, comhaireamh teagmhas a thaispeáint, gan ach línte arís agus arís eile a thaispeáint, neamhaird a dhéanamh de charachtair áirithe agus comparáid a dhéanamh ar réimsí ar leith.

Conas a aimsím sraitheanna dúblacha in Unix?

Conas taifid dhúblacha de chomhad a fháil i Linux?

  1. Ag baint úsáide as sort agus uniq: $ sort file | uniq -d Linux. …
  2. bealach awk chun línte dúblacha a fháil: $ awk '{a [$ 0] ++} DEIREADH {le haghaidh (i in a) más rud é (a [i]> 1) priontáil i;}' comhad Linux. …
  3. Ag baint úsáide as bealach perl: $ perl -ne '$ h {$ _} ++; END {foreach (eochracha% h) {priontáil $ _ más $ h {$ _}> 1;}}' comhad Linux. …
  4. Bealach perl eile:…
  5. Script bhlaosc chun taifid dhúblacha a fháil / a fháil:

3 ok. 2012 g.

Conas a chomhaireamh tú línte in Unix?

Conas Línte a Chomhaireamh i gcomhad in UNIX / Linux

  1. Nuair a reáchtáiltear an t-ordú “wc -l” ar an gcomhad seo, aschuir sé an comhaireamh líne in éineacht le hainm an chomhaid. $ wc -l file01.txt 5 file01.txt.
  2. Chun ainm an chomhaid a fhágáil ar lár ón toradh, úsáid: $ wc -l <file01.txt 5.
  3. Is féidir leat an t-aschur ordaithe a sholáthar don ordú wc i gcónaí trí phíopa a úsáid. Mar shampla:

Conas a phriontálfaidh mé línte dúblacha i Linux?

Míniú: Ní dhéanann an script awk ach an 1ú réimse scartha spáis den chomhad a phriontáil. Úsáid $ N chun an réimse Nth a phriontáil. sórtáil é agus comhaireamh uniq -c tarluithe gach líne.

Conas a bhaintear línte dúblacha in Unix?

Úsáidtear an t-ordú uniq chun línte dúblacha a bhaint de chomhad téacs i Linux. De réir réamhshocraithe, déanann an t-ordú seo gach ceann de na línte in aice láimhe ach an chéad cheann díobh a scriosadh, ionas nach ndéantar aon línte aschuir a athdhéanamh. De rogha air sin, ní féidir leis ach línte dúblacha a phriontáil.

Conas awk a úsáid in Unix?

Airteagail gaolmhara

  1. Oibríochtaí AWK: (a) Scanadh líne comhad de réir líne. (b) Roinntear gach líne ionchuir i réimsí. (c) Déan comparáid idir líne / réimsí ionchuir agus patrún. (d) Déanann sé gníomh (anna) ar línte comhoiriúnaithe.
  2. Úsáideach Do: (a) Comhaid sonraí a athrú. (b) Tuarascálacha formáidithe a tháirgeadh.
  3. Tógann Clárú:

31 ean. 2021 g.

Conas a bhainim comhaid dhúblacha i Linux?

4 Uirlisí Úsáideacha chun Comhaid Dúblacha a Aimsiú agus a Scriosadh i Linux

  1. Rdfind - Aimsíonn Comhaid Dúblacha i Linux. Tagann Rdfind ó aimsiú sonraí iomarcacha. …
  2. Fdupes - Scanadh do Chomhaid Dúblacha i Linux. Is clár eile é Fdupes a ligeann duit comhaid dhúblacha a aithint ar do chóras. …
  3. dupeGuru - Faigh Comhaid Dúblacha i Linux. …
  4. FSlint - Aimsitheoir Comhad Dúblach do Linux.

2 ean. 2020 g.

Conas a dhéanann tú línte grep a chomhaireamh?

Trí úsáid a bhaint as grep -c amháin, comhaireamh líon na línte ina bhfuil an focal meaitseála in ionad líon na lasán iomlán. Is é an rogha -o an rud a insíonn do grep gach cluiche a aschur i líne uathúil agus ansin insíonn wc -l do wc líon na línte a chomhaireamh. Seo mar a asbhaintear líon iomlán na bhfocal meaitseála.

Conas a aimsíonn tú an líne is faide in Unix?

3.2.

Now we can just assemble the wc -L and grep commands to find all longest lines: $ grep -E “^.

How many lines File Linux?

Is é an bealach is éasca chun líon na línte, na bhfocal agus na gcarachtar sa chomhad téacs a chomhaireamh ná an t-ordú Linux “wc” a úsáid i gcríochfort. Go bunúsach ciallaíonn an t-ordú “wc” “líon focal” agus le paraiméadair roghnacha éagsúla is féidir le duine é a úsáid chun líon na línte, na bhfocal agus na gcarachtar i gcomhad téacs a chomhaireamh.

Conas a dhéanaim dúblaigh a shórtáil agus a bhaint i Linux?

Ní mór duit píopaí sliogáin a úsáid in éineacht leis an dá fhóntas líne ordaithe Linux seo a leanas chun línte téacs dúblacha a shórtáil agus a bhaint:

  1. ordú sórtála - Sórtáil línte de chomhaid téacs i gcórais cosúil le Linux agus Unix.
  2. uniq command - Déan línte arís agus arís eile ar Linux nó Unix a thuairisciú nó a fhágáil ar lár.

21 Nollaig. 2018 g.

Cén t-ordú a úsáidtear chun línte arís agus arís eile a aimsiú i Linux?

Cén t-ordú a úsáidtear chun línte athdhéanta agus línte neamh-athdhéanta a aimsiú? Míniú: Nuair a dhéanaimid comhaid a chomhcheangail nó a chumasc, is féidir linn teacht ar fhadhb na n-iontrálacha dúblacha ag luascadh isteach. Tairgeann UNIX ordú speisialta (uniq) ar féidir a úsáid chun na hiontrálacha dúblacha seo a láimhseáil.

Cad a dhéanann grep i Linux?

Is uirlis líne ordaithe Linux / Unix é Grep a úsáidtear chun sreang carachtar a chuardach i gcomhad sonraithe. Tugtar slonn rialta ar an bpatrún cuardaigh téacs. Nuair a aimsíonn sé cluiche, déanann sé an líne a phriontáil leis an toradh. Tá an t-ordú grep áisiúil agus tú ag cuardach trí chomhaid loga mhóra.

Conas is féidir liom fáil réidh le línte dúblacha?

Téigh go dtí an roghchlár Uirlisí> Scratchpad nó brúigh F2. Greamaigh an téacs isteach an fhuinneog agus brúigh an cnaipe Déan. Ba cheart an rogha Bain Línte Dúblacha a roghnú cheana féin sa roghchlár anuas de réir réamhshocraithe. Mura bhfuil, roghnaigh é ar dtús.

Conas a bhaintear línte dúblacha i Python?

Teagaisc Python chun línte dúblacha a bhaint as comhad téacs :

  1. Ar dtús, oscail an comhad ionchuir sa mhód ‘léigh’ mar nílimid ag léamh ach ábhar an chomhaid seo.
  2. Oscail an comhad aschuir i mód scríofa toisc go bhfuil muid ag scríobh ábhar don chomhad seo.
  3. Léigh líne ar líne ón gcomhad ionchuir agus seiceáil ar scríobhadh aon líne cosúil leis seo chuig an gcomhad aschuir.

How do I remove duplicates from grep?

If you want to count duplicates or have a more complicated scheme for determining what is or is not a duplicate, then pipe the sort output to uniq : grep These filename | sort | uniq and see man uniq` for options. Show activity on this post. -m NUM, –max-count=NUM Stop reading a file after NUM matching lines.

Cosúil leis an bpost seo? Roinn le do chairde le do thoil:
OS Inniu